Raising Cane's opened Tuesday morning in Johnson City where customers lined up since Monday night to receive gift baskets and win free Cane's.
Twenty winners earned free Cane's for a year + the store donated $2,000 to Washington County Animal Shelter and hired nearly 140 employees.
Yesterday, the Washington County Sheriff's Office hosted its fourth annual Champ Camp at the Appalachian Fairgrounds, where over 70 kids learned officer skills including K9 demonstrations, safety driving courses, and equipment reviews — the event was free through donations.
A Johnson City resident launched a website mapping prospective data center sites under the new zoning rules and identified two possible parcels at a 200-foot setback & none at 500 feet.
City officials plan to release the data at the July 16 meeting as residents request clearer guidance.
